NYC VISTA: DYCD Civic Engagement Support VISTA
 
 
 
Department of Youth & Community Development (DYCD) invests in a network of community-based organizations and programs that aim to alleviate the effects of poverty and provide opportunities for New Yorkers and communities to flourish. DYCD supports New York City youth and their families by funding a wide range of high-quality youth and community development programs, including: After School, Community Development, Family Support, Literacy Services, Youth Services, and Youth Workforce Development. In keeping with DYCD’s guiding principles, DYCD promotes civic engagement and open communication to gain input from, inform and empower communities. The civic engagement initiative will support DYCD by ensuring that community members and partners, including funded programs, are equipped to navigate and participate in civic systems successfully.

Member Duties : The VISTA project will encompass DYCD’s overall vision to build the knowledge of CBO staff that provide service to DYCD participants, enhance funded program practices at a systematic level thru intentional interventions such at the civic engagement framework, and ensure sustainable CBO change thru access to resources. Utilizing DYCD’s civic engagement framework which establishes the knowledge needed for New Yorkers to effect change and ultimately alleviate the effects of poverty, the DYCD VISTA project will build the capacity and expertise of CBO funded programs and staff to develop and deliver civic engagement opportunities that promote an end to poverty across communities in NYC. The VISTA project will support funded programs in accessing vital resources related to civic engagement and anti-poverty by creating professional development opportunities, bringing supports to communities in the form of training, forums, and resource shares, and partnerships.
